> There is a way to take the EXPECT and TCL out of the equation -- you need to get out of 5250-land and into VT100-land.
>
> The way to do that is is to use the 5799 PTL - iSeries Tools for Developers, which contains a no-charge VNC server which you run on your AS/400. Then use a VNC viewer to connection from your PC to an XWindows session on the AS/400 and you are a VT100 device type and can open a shell and do all the SSH commands.
